THE NEWLY LAUNCHED JBL TOUR PRO 2 EARBUDS HAVE A SCREEN

Are we holding the future of wireless earbuds in my hands? Or are JBL’s Tour Pro 2 buds – with a charging case that has its own built-in display – a parlor trick negated by the smartwatch? The Tour Pro 2 are the first to come to market with an interactive case; HP has announced something similar and Apple patent filings suggest that the AirPods maker is at least exploring this concept. But JBL’s earbuds are here now and start shipping today in the US after launching in other markets earlier this year. The Tour Pro 2 include an exhaustive, well-rounded list of features. Their adaptive noise-cancellation, which adjusts in real time based on the loudness of your environment, is impressively strong and comparable to the upper tier of competition. Battery life is another highlight and rated at up to eight hours of continuous listening with ANC on or 10 with it off. JBL also notes that the earbuds are ready for LE Audio spec and will be updated to enable it once the spec goes mainstream.


THE THINKPHONE IS TAKING MOTOROLA IN THE RIGHT DIRECTION

The Lenovo ThinkPhone by Motorola, has a few things going for it that recent mainstream, high-end Moto devices like 2022’s Edge Plus have come up short on: a full IP68 water-resistance rating, a healthy four-year security update policy, and a sensible $699 asking price. There’s also a capable Snapdragon 8 Plus Gen 1 chipset and a big 6.6-inch 1080p OLED with a smooth-scrolling 144Hz refresh rate. On top of all that, there’s Motorola’s Ready for PC, a suite of continuity features that work with Windows PCs and is right at home with Lenovo’s ThinkPad business laptops. At the heart of the ThinkPhone is a Snapdragon 8 Plus Gen 1 chipset, which Qualcomm released in the second half of 2022 as a step-up version of the 8 Gen 1. It’s paired with 8GB of RAM, which is plenty for keeping daily tasks running smoothly. The ThinkPhone’s screen is a large 6.6-inch OLED panel with 1080p resolution and a top refresh rate of 144Hz. It’s bright enough to see in bright daylight, and that high refresh rate gives a smooth appearance to animations and scrolling.
